How to Make Grilled Chicken Broccoli Bowls

  1. Grill the Chicken: Start by seasoning the chicken breasts with olive oil, salt, and pepper. Grill them over medium-high heat for about 6-7 minutes per side until they’re cooked through, reaching an internal temperature of 165°F. Flip once for even cooking.

  2. Roast the Broccoli: While the chicken is grilling, toss the broccoli florets with olive oil and lemon juice. Spread them on a baking sheet and roast at 400°F for 15-20 minutes until tender and slightly crispy.

  3. Cook the Grains: Prepare your chosen grains (rice, quinoa, or couscous) according to package instructions. Once cooked, fluff them with a fork and keep warm for assembly.

  4. Make the Garlic Sauce: In a small saucepan, melt butter over medium heat. Add the minced garlic and sauté until fragrant, about 1 minute. Stir in the heavy cream, season with salt and pepper, and let it simmer until thickened, about 3-5 minutes.

  5. Assemble the Bowls: In serving bowls, layer the warm grains as the base. Slice the grilled chicken and arrange it on top, then add the roasted broccoli. Drizzle generously with the creamy garlic sauce and finish with a sprinkle of fresh herbs.

Expert Tips for Grilled Chicken Broccoli Bowls

  • Perfectly Grilled Chicken: Use a meat thermometer to ensure the chicken reaches 165°F for safe and juicy results.

  • Roast for Crispiness: Avoid overcrowding the baking sheet while roasting broccoli; this ensures even cooking and that delightful crispy texture.

  • Revive the Sauce: If the creamy garlic sauce thickens upon reheating, add a splash of water or milk to bring it back to the perfect consistency.

  • Season Generously: Don’t skimp on the salt and pepper; proper seasoning enhances the flavor of all components in these Grilled Chicken Broccoli Bowls.

  • Meal Prep Magic: Prepare and store individual ingredients separately to keep them fresh, making it easy to assemble a delicious meal throughout the week.

Make Ahead Options

These Grilled Chicken & Broccoli Bowls with Creamy Garlic Sauce are ideal for busy home cooks looking to save time throughout the week! You can grill the chicken and roast the broccoli up to 3 days in advance and store them in airtight containers in the refrigerator. The creamy garlic sauce can also be made ahead and stored separately; simply refrigerate it for up to 5 days. To maintain quality, ensure everything is cooled before sealing, and reheat gently on the stove or microwave, adding a splash of water to the sauce if it thickens. Grilled Chicken & Broccoli Bowls with Creamy Garlic Sauce Recipe FAQs

Can I use frozen broccoli for this recipe?
Absolutely! You can use frozen broccoli; just remember it may require a slightly longer roasting time—about 25-30 minutes at 400°F. Make sure to thaw and drain excess moisture beforehand to avoid sogginess.

How should I store leftovers of Grilled Chicken Broccoli Bowls?
Store leftovers in airtight containers for up to 3-4 days in the refrigerator. Make sure the chicken stays moist by letting it cool before sealing. Reheat on the stovetop or microwave, adding a splash of water or milk if the sauce thickens.

Can I freeze the Grilled Chicken & Broccoli Bowls?
Yes, you can freeze portions in airtight containers or freezer bags for up to 3 months! To do this, cool the bowls completely before packing. Thaw overnight in the fridge, then reheat. If needed, add a bit of liquid to revive the sauce.

What if my garlic sauce is too thick?
No worries! If your creamy garlic sauce thickens upon reheating, simply add a splash of water or milk to loosen it up. Stir well until you reach your desired consistency—it’ll be as good as new!

Is this recipe suitable for someone with a dairy allergy?
Definitely! For a dairy-free version of the Grilled Chicken & Broccoli Bowls, substitute the heavy cream with a plant-based cream and replace butter with olive oil or vegan butter. Enjoy!

How can I make the dish spicier?
The more the merrier! If you enjoy a spicy kick, I recommend adding red pepper flakes or cayenne pepper to the garlic sauce for that extra flair. Start with a pinch, taste, and adjust to your heat preference.

Grilled Chicken & Broccoli Bowls with Creamy Garlic Bliss

Enjoy these Grilled Chicken & Broccoli Bowls with Creamy Garlic Sauce for a quick, healthy dinner that satisfies your cravings.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Total Time 30 minutes
Servings: 4 bowls
Course: Dinner
Cuisine: American
Calories: 600

Ingredients
  

For the Chicken
  • 2 pieces Chicken breasts Can substitute with grilled tofu or chickpeas.
  • 2 tablespoons Olive oil Essential for marinating.
  • 1 teaspoon Salt Simple seasoning.
  • 1 teaspoon Pepper Simple seasoning.
For the Broccoli
  • 4 cups Broccoli florets Vibrant veggies, can substitute with zucchini or bell peppers.
  • 2 tablespoons Lemon juice Brightens the dish.
  • 1 tablespoon Olive oil For tossing the broccoli.
For the Grains
  • 1 cup Rice or quinoa Serves as a satisfying base.
For the Creamy Garlic Sauce
  • 4 cloves Garlic Fresh is preferred.
  • 1 cup Heavy cream Substitute plant-based cream for dairy-free version.
  • 2 tablespoons Butter Adds richness.
Optional Garnishes
  • 2 tablespoons Parsley or chives Fresh herbs for garnish.

Equipment

  • grill
  • Baking Sheet
  • Saucepan

Method
 

How to Make Grilled Chicken Broccoli Bowls
  1. Grill the Chicken: Season the chicken breasts with olive oil, salt, and pepper. Grill over medium-high heat for 6-7 minutes per side until cooked through.
  2. Roast the Broccoli: Toss the broccoli florets with olive oil and lemon juice. Spread on a baking sheet and roast at 400°F for 15-20 minutes.
  3. Cook the Grains: Prepare chosen grains according to package instructions, then fluff and keep warm.
  4. Make the Garlic Sauce: Melt butter in a saucepan, add minced garlic, and sauté. Stir in heavy cream and simmer until thickened.
  5. Assemble the Bowls: Layer grains in bowls, top with sliced grilled chicken and roasted broccoli, then drizzle with garlic sauce and add herbs.
